Output 950df68100659ae686daa7e4d3fc187cfbaebd0445fef6cde1eabbdbdb913843:0

value
514730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c3ffe6c389631dea401fbe9f492238df78e0c0 OP_EQUAL
address
3N6BQcZWDSkh5h3qSE3GAxgGxHa2GEtfSX
transaction
950df68100659ae686daa7e4d3fc187cfbaebd0445fef6cde1eabbdbdb913843
spent
true